Lag / Long Load Times / Save Game Bloat / Excess Townies

[ Edited ]
★★★ Apprentice

Product: The Sims 4
Platform:PC
Which language are you playing the game in? English
How often does the bug occur? Every time (100%)
What is your current game version number? 1.77.146.1030
What expansions, game packs, and stuff packs do you have installed? All except for Journey to Batuu
Steps: How can we find the bug ourselves? Load the game and it takes far longer than it should on any loading screen, play in live mode for a few minutes and the lag is very noticeable
What happens when the bug occurs? Loading times have increased significantly, time stands still in live mode when pausing/unpausing, the UI lags when selecting items (takes the pie menu multiple seconds to display after clicking an object) or switching between sims, save file has been bloated, game is generating mass amounts of townies. Over 90% of my memory is being used when the game is running, it's using over 24GB of RAM.
What do you expect to see? Load times should be ~15 seconds but are currently around 3-4 minutes. The game should be pausing/unpausing instantly with no lag. I should be able to select items/objects with no lag. I should be able to switch between sims instantly. My save files should be much smaller. The game shoudn't be generating 100s of townies.
Have you installed any customization with the game, e.g. Custom Content or Mods? Yes
Did this issue appear after a specific patch or change you made to your system? Yes
Please describe the patch or change you made. Cottage Living release

I have tried removing all of my mods/CC and the issue is exactly the same. When I realised the game was generating a huge amount of households (all seemingly empty/invisible) I spent hours removing them but the lag and save game bloat is still the same. The lag isn't as bad now since I removed all the excess households but it's still noticeable (it was completely unplayable before). Saving times have also increased significantly. 

 

I have uploaded a few of my saves here which includes a save from a few days ago which was much smaller in size compared to now, a save where the game was at its worst with 100s of empty households generated, a save after I removed all the excess households and had mods/cc removed and a save after I removed all the excess households and had mods/cc back in. 

 

Also added a screenshot of my memory usage when running TS4.

Re: Glitching

Hero

Try resetting your user files as described in the factory reset described in this post: http://answers.ea.com/t5/The-Sims-4/FAQ-Troubleshooting-Steps-amp-Known-Issues/m-p/3621199

 

You won't loose anything. Just make sure to not delete any files  and make a backup.

 

After renaming, repair your game by right clicking on the game in Origin.

 

Try on a new game with nothing added back first (start new game). If it works, put back your save game and try again. If it still works, you can start putting stuff back.

 

  • Options.ini (or just re-set all your settings manually)
  • Tray Folder
  • Screenshots/Videos/Custom music
  • Rest of the save games (leave out slot_00000001.save which is the autosave and no longer needed - if you still have it)
  • Custom content like clothing, hair, skins, make up ....
  • ConfigOverride, if you have your own configuration files.
  • Mods (one by one, making sure they all still work)

The rest does not need putting back, cause they are mostly cache files that recreate or log files that are not needed for the game.
